hugely

adverb: extremely; "he was enormously popular" [syn: {enormously}, {tremendously}, {staggeringly}]

Huge \Huge\, adjective [Compar. {Huger}; superl. {Hugest}.] [OE. huge, hoge, OF. ahuge, ahoge.] Very large; enormous; immense; excessive; -- used esp. of material bulk, but often of qualities, extent, etc.; as, a huge ox; a huge space; a huge difference. ''The huge confusion.'' --Chapman. ''A huge filly.'' --Jer. Taylor. -- {Huge"ly}, adverb -- {Huge"ness}, noun

Doth it not flow as hugely as the sea. --Shak.

Syn: Enormous; gigantic; colossal; immense; prodigious; vast.
